  Allow empty NUMA memory domains to support Threadripper2
  
  The AMD Threadripper 2990WX is basically a slightly crippled Epyc.
  Rather than having 4 memory controllers, one per NUMA domain, it has
  only 2  memory controllers enabled. This means that only 2 of the
  4 NUMA domains can be populated with physical memory, and the
  others are empty.
  
  Add support to FreeBSD for empty NUMA domains by:
  
  - creating empty memory domains when parsing the SRAT table,
      rather than failing to parse the table
  - not running the pageout deamon threads in empty domains
  - adding defensive code to UMA to avoid allocating from empty domains
  - adding defensive code to cpuset to avoid binding to an empty domain
      Thanks to Jeff for suggesting this strategy.
